Dodgers Close to Re-Signing Chris Taylor to a Deal

It’s been an offseason of a lot of heartbreak for Dodgers fans in Los Angeles. Over the last few days, they’ve had to watch guys like Corey Seager, Corey Knebel, and Max Scherer all sign new deals with different teams. And what were they rewarded with by Andrew Friedman? A free-agent contract for Daniel Hudson.

But with just hours to go until MLB experiences a labor lockout, Andy appears to be rewarding fans. The Dodgers are reportedly close to re-signing Chris Taylor on a deal, per ESPN’S Jeff Passan. The deal is expected to be completed before the deadline at 11:59 pm eastern time.
